深度解析:开发者如何高效运用DeepSeek?CSDN博主实战指南
2025.09.17 10:19浏览量:0简介:本文汇总CSDN博主对DeepSeek的深度使用经验,从场景适配、代码优化到性能调优,为开发者提供可落地的实战指南。
一、DeepSeek的核心能力与开发者适配场景
DeepSeek作为一款以高效推理和低资源消耗为特点的AI模型,其核心能力集中在代码生成、逻辑推理、多轮对话优化三大领域。CSDN博主@AI架构师张工通过对比测试指出,在算法题求解场景中,DeepSeek-V3的代码正确率较同类模型提升18%,尤其在动态规划类问题中展现出更强的结构化思维。
开发者适配场景可分为三类:
- 快速原型开发:利用模型生成基础代码框架,例如@Python极客李的实践显示,使用DeepSeek生成Flask后端接口可节省40%的初始开发时间。
- 复杂问题拆解:当处理分布式系统故障时,模型可将”服务调用超时”问题拆解为网络延迟、序列化开销、线程池配置等8个维度。
- 知识库增强:结合私有数据微调后,模型在特定领域(如医疗影像分析)的准确率可达专业工程师水平。
二、代码生成场景的深度实践
1. 提示词工程优化
CSDN百万阅读博主@代码诗人王磊提出”三段式提示法”:
# 示例:生成排序算法
角色设定:你是一位有10年经验的算法工程师
任务描述:用Python实现快速排序,要求:
1. 添加详细注释
2. 包含边界条件处理
3. 输出时间复杂度分析
输出格式:代码块+文字说明
该结构使代码可用率从62%提升至89%。实测数据显示,明确指定输出格式可使模型生成符合PEP8规范的代码概率提高3倍。
2. 多轮对话修正机制
在生成复杂业务逻辑时,@全栈工程师陈浩推荐”分步验证法”:
这种交互方式使代码缺陷率从23%降至7%,特别适用于金融、医疗等高安全要求领域。
三、性能优化与资源控制技巧
1. 计算资源动态调配
@云计算专家刘明通过实验发现,设置max_tokens=512
时,模型在2核4G虚拟机上的响应时间可控制在1.2秒内。其配置建议:
# 资源优化配置示例
response = client.generate(
prompt="...",
max_tokens=512, # 控制输出长度
temperature=0.3, # 降低创造性,提升确定性
top_p=0.9, # 核采样参数
stop=["\n\n"] # 避免多余换行
)
2. 私有化部署方案
对于数据敏感场景,@企业架构师赵阳提出容器化部署方案:
- 使用Docker构建镜像:
docker build -t deepseek-server .
- 配置Nginx负载均衡,支持横向扩展
- 通过Prometheus监控API调用延迟,当p99超过800ms时自动触发扩容
该方案在某银行项目中实现日均千万级调用,平均延迟稳定在350ms。
四、行业解决方案案例库
1. 电商推荐系统优化
@大数据工程师林薇分享的实践显示,将DeepSeek接入推荐引擎后:
- 冷启动问题解决率提升40%
- 用户画像生成时间从72小时缩短至8小时
- 关键代码片段:
def generate_user_profile(user_data):
prompt = f"""根据以下用户行为数据生成画像:
浏览记录:{user_data['browsing']}
购买记录:{user_data['purchases']}
要求输出JSON格式,包含:
- 兴趣分类(一级/二级)
- 消费能力等级
- 近期关注点"""
return deepseek_api.generate(prompt)
2. 工业缺陷检测模型
在制造业场景中,@机器学习专家吴强通过微调实现:
- 准备1000张标注缺陷图片
- 使用LoRA技术进行参数高效微调
- 最终模型在PCB板检测中达到98.7%的准确率
微调脚本示例:
from peft import LoraConfig, get_peft_model
config = LoraConfig(
r=16,
lora_alpha=32,
target_modules=["query_key_value"],
lora_dropout=0.1
)
model = get_peft_model(base_model, config)
五、开发者常见问题解决方案
1. 上下文丢失问题
当对话超过10轮时,@NLP工程师周婷建议:
- 定期总结对话要点
- 使用
system
消息重置上下文:messages = [
{"role": "system", "content": "当前任务:优化支付系统代码。已解决:数据库连接池配置。待解决:分布式锁实现"}
]
2. 行业知识不足
对于垂直领域,@医疗AI专家郑浩推荐:
- 构建知识图谱增强提示
- 示例:在医疗场景中先输入”请参考以下医学指南:{指南内容}”,再提出具体问题
六、未来趋势与技能升级建议
CSDN年度博主@技术前瞻者马峰预测,2024年开发者需重点提升:
- 提示词工程:掌握结构化提示、思维链(CoT)等高级技巧
- 模型评估能力:建立量化评估体系,包含功能正确性、性能、安全等维度
- 混合架构设计:结合传统算法与AI模型的优势
建议开发者每月进行一次”AI能力审计”,记录模型在典型任务中的表现,形成个人知识库。例如某游戏公司通过持续审计,将AI生成代码的集成周期从3天缩短至8小时。
本文整合的23位CSDN博主经验表明,DeepSeek的有效使用需要建立”提示词-验证-优化”的闭环流程。开发者应避免将其视为黑盒工具,而是作为增强开发效率的智能助手。通过持续实践和反馈调整,可实现人均开发效能提升2-3倍的显著效果。
发表评论
登录后可评论,请前往 登录 或 注册